Ning Feng violin; Serena Wang piano
Wigmore Hall, W1U 2BP , [Venue Details]This concert will be approximately 2 hours in duration, including an interval
Known for his breathtaking virtuosity and lyrical, expressive playing, Ning Feng offers a programme of seductive works composed in Paris between 1885 and 1943. He opens with Poulenc’s contemplative sonata, written in memory of the visionary poet Federico García Lorca, executed by nationalists soon after the outbreak of the Spanish Civil War 90 years ago.
